The growth hormone releasing peptide, in plain words
Your body naturally produces hormones vital for repair and rejuvenation. As you age, these levels often decrease, affecting your energy, sleep, and physical recovery. This decline can leave you feeling less vibrant, impacting your daily life and activities in the Oakland area.
Imagine a way to encourage your body to produce more of its own growth hormone. This growth hormone releasing peptide acts on your pituitary gland, stimulating it to release growth hormone in a natural, pulsatile manner. It does not introduce synthetic hormones directly, working instead to optimize your body’s innate processes.
Specifically, Sermorelin Injection is a growth hormone-releasing hormone (GHRH) analog. This therapy aims to increase your body’s natural output of growth hormone, which in turn elevates levels of Insulin-like Growth Factor 1 (IGF-1). Higher IGF-1 levels often correlate with improved body composition, better sleep, and enhanced recovery.

What sermorelin injection actually is
For adults in Laney College, Oakland, sermorelin is a 29-amino-acid peptide that mimics the first portion of natural growth hormone releasing hormone (GHRH). When injected subcutaneously, sermorelin signals the pituitary gland to release the body's own growth hormone in a pulsatile, physiologic pattern. This is the key difference from synthetic human growth hormone (HGH): sermorelin asks the body to produce its own GH, rather than supplying GH from outside.
Because of that mechanism, sermorelin therapy is typically prescribed for adults whose GH output has declined with age. It is dispensed in the United States as a compounded subcutaneous injection from licensed 503A and 503B pharmacies, and it requires a written prescription from a clinician after consultation and lab work.

Is sermorelin the same as HGH?
No. HGH is the growth hormone molecule itself. Sermorelin is a releasing peptide that prompts the body to produce its own GH in a natural pulsatile rhythm. This avoids the supraphysiological peaks that direct HGH injection can produce.

Where do I inject?
Subcutaneous injection into the abdomen at least one inch from the navel, or into the outer thigh. The injection is small (insulin syringe gauge), administered nightly on an empty stomach. The protocol is typically five days on, two days off.
